This Advanced Skill Certificate in Engineering Design Thinking for Children equips young learners with a foundational understanding of the engineering design process. They will develop crucial problem-solving skills through hands-on projects and engaging activities, fostering creativity and innovation.
The program's learning outcomes include mastering design thinking methodologies, from brainstorming and prototyping to testing and iteration. Children will learn to effectively communicate their design solutions and collaborate effectively within a team environment, skills highly valued in STEM fields. The curriculum also incorporates elements of digital fabrication and computer-aided design (CAD) software.
The certificate program typically spans 8 weeks, with flexible scheduling options to accommodate different learning paces. Each week focuses on a specific stage of the engineering design process, culminating in a final project showcase where children present their innovative solutions.
